How Does an LED Message Board Work?

At its core, an LED message board operates by activating tiny semiconductors called LEDs arranged in a grid or matrix. Controlled by a central circuit board (or controller), these LEDs light up in specific patterns to spell out messages, show symbols, or render animations. The content is usually scheduled or programmed via specialized software, which may support wireless, USB, or web-based updates.

Step-by-Step: How Content Appears on an LED Message Board

Message Creation: Users compose the text or select pre-designed graphics using software or a control panel.

Data Transmission: The message is sent to the LED board controller via USB, network connection, or wireless signal.

Signal Processing: The controller translates the message into electrical signals that determine which LEDs should turn on or off.

LED Activation: LEDs illuminate in the programmed sequence to display the desired message or animation.

Display Update: The message board can be updated in real-time for live information or scheduled to change automatically.

How Does an LED Message Board Work?

What Is the Technology Behind LED Message Boards?

LED message boards are built from grids or matrices of LEDs. Each LED acts as a single pixel (picture element) that can be switched on or off, or varied in brightness and color, depending on the display type (monochrome, tri-color, or RGB full-color).

How Is Content Displayed?

Messages and graphics are displayed by coordinating which LEDs light up at any moment, forming text, numbers, icons, or animations. This process is managed by a microcontroller or embedded computer – commonly referred to as a controller board – which receives content instructions from a connected device or software.

Input methods: USB, Wi-Fi, Ethernet, serial ports, or cloud-based software.

Programming: Users can change messages via desktop or mobile apps.

Display refresh: Fast switching allows for scrolling, flashing, or animating messages.

Common Questions About LED Message Board Operation

How Do You Program an LED Message Board?

Most LED message boards can be programmed through a computer application, mobile app, or a built-in keypad. Users type or upload the desired message, select options for fonts, colors, brightness, or animations, and then transmit the data to the board electronically.

Wired updates: via USB or Ethernet cables

Wireless updates: via Wi-Fi or Bluetooth

Cloud-based solutions: manage multiple boards remotely

What Makes LED Boards Different from LCD or Traditional Signage?

Unlike traditional printed signage or LCD displays, LED message boards emit light directly from each pixel, making them highly visible, energy-efficient, and suitable for both indoor and outdoor environments. They also offer dynamic content updates, while printed signs are static.

How Does an LED Message Board Work?

What Is the Basic Working Principle?

The core mechanism of an LED message board involves receiving digital instructions (such as messages or images), converting these into signals, and then illuminating specific LEDs to form the desired content. The process happens rapidly to enable scrolling text, animated graphics, or changing information in near-real-time.

What Components Make Up an LED Message Board?

LED Modules: Arrays or matrices of LED lights that display the actual message or graphics.

Controller Board: The central processing unit that interprets input data and manages the illumination of LEDs.

Power Supply: Converts AC power to the required low-voltage DC for the board and LEDs.

Input Interface: Ports or wireless modules (USB, Ethernet, Wi-Fi, etc.) for receiving new messages or content.

Enclosure / Housing: Weatherproof or tamper-resistant casing for protection and mounting.

Frequently Asked Questions (FAQs) About LED Message Boards

Are LED Message Boards the Same as Digital Signage?

While all LED message boards are a form of digital signage, not all digital signage uses LED technology. Digital signage also includes LCD screens and projectors. LED boards stand out for brightness and durability, especially outdoors.

How Do LED Message Boards Receive Messages?

LED message boards accept inputs through various methods, including direct computer connections, mobile apps, remote cloud management, or USB drives. The input method depends on the brand and model.

Can LED Message Boards Display Graphics in Addition to Text?

Yes, many modern LED message boards can show basic graphics, animations, and logos, depending on their resolution and the software used for content management.

What Is the Lifespan of an LED Message Board?

High-quality LED message boards typically last 50,000 to 100,000 hours (5–10 years or more), depending on usage and environmental conditions.
